Research Interests

  • Bayesian Optimization and Control
  • Machine learning from few training data
  • Domain-specific spatio-temporal covariance estimation
  • Unsupervised learning

Publications

  • Sosulski, Jan, and Michael Tangermann. "Introducing Block-Toeplitz Covariance Matrices to Remaster Linear Discriminant Analysis for Event-related Potential Brain-computer Interfaces." arXiv preprint arXiv:2202.02001 (2022).
  • Meinel, Andreas, Sosulski, Jan, Schraivogel, Stefan, Reis, Janine, and Michael Tangermann. "Manipulating single-trial motor performance in chronic stroke patients by closed-loop brain state interaction." IEEE Transactions on Neural Systems and Rehabilitation Engineering 29 (2021): 1806-1816.
  • Sosulski, Jan, Jan-Philipp Kemmer, and Michael Tangermann. "Improving covariance matrices derived from tiny training datasets for the classification of event-related potentials with linear discriminant analysis." Neuroinformatics 19.3 (2021): 461-476.
  • Sosulski, Jan, Hübner, David, Klein, Aaron, and Michael Tangermann. "Online Optimization of Stimulation Speed in an Auditory Brain-Computer Interface under Time Constraints." arXiv preprint arXiv:2109.06011 (2021).
  • Sosulski, Jan, and Michael Tangermann. "Spatial filters for auditory evoked potentials transfer between different experimental conditions." 8th GBCIC. 2019. Best Poster award.
  • Sosulski, Jan, and Michael Tangermann. "Extremely Reduced Data Sets Indicate Optimal Stimulation Parameters for Classification in Brain-Computer Interfaces." 2019 41st Annual International Conference of the IEEE Engineering in Medicine and Biology Society (EMBC). IEEE, 2019.
